Ambassador Jayatilleka visits oldest Higher Educational Institution in Russia
On January 30, 2019 Ambassador of Sri Lanka to the Russian Federation Dr. Dayan Jayatilleka and Madame Sanja Jayatilleka paid a visit to the Institute of Oriental Studies of the Russian Academy of Sciences, the largest and the oldest higher education establishment in Russia in the area of the Humanities with 500 researchers working on the Asian and North African history and culture, economics and politics, and languages.
Ambassador Jayatilleka and Madame Jayatilleka were received by the President of the Institute, Professor Vitaly Naumkin, and the Head of Indian Studies Dr. Tatiana Shaumyan.
Ambassador Jayatilleka’s visit to «Russia’s Harvard» featured on Moscow State Institute of International Relations (MGIMO) University website
Moscow State Institute of International Relations abbreviated as MGIMO University, is an academic institution run by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Russia, which is widely considered the most prestigious university in Russia. Henry Kissinger called it the "Harvard of Russia" because it educates a constellation of the political, economic, and intellectual elite.
It was founded by Stalin in 1944 for the purpose of enhancing the education and training of the Soviet diplomatic corps for the new, post-War II global environment.
Since 1992 the University is led by Professor Anatoly Torkunov, who is also a MGIMO graduate, holds two doctoral degrees in History and Political Science and has the rank of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ary.
